Pat Butler Elementary names new principal for next school year

Christy Holman.
Christy Holman brings over a decade of experience to new role
– The Paso Robles Joint Unified School District announced that Christy Holman has been selected as the principal of Pat Butler Elementary School for the 2025-2026 school year.
Holman is currently serving as the interim principal at Pat Butler Elementary during the current school year. She has worked for more than a decade in the Paso Robles Joint Unified School District in various roles, including elementary teacher, sixth-grade teacher at Flamson Middle School, and literacy coach.
“We are thrilled to have Ms. Holman continue her leadership at Pat Butler,” Superintendent Loftus said. “Her experience, vision, and dedication to our students and staff make her an excellent fit for this role.”
The district stated that Holman’s leadership is expected to ensure a smooth transition and continued progress for the Pat Butler Elementary School community.
